怎么生成不重复的100个随机数 Excel函数公式:生成随机数、不重复随机数技巧?

[更新]
·
·
分类:互联网
2427 阅读

怎么生成不重复的100个随机数

Excel函数公式:生成随机数、不重复随机数技巧?

Excel函数公式:生成随机数、不重复随机数技巧?

一、生成0-1之间的随机数。方法:1、在目标单元格中输入公式:=RAND()。2、如果要重新生成,按F9刷新即可。解读: Rand函数没有参数,可以生成0-1之间的随机数,小数位数可以具体到15位。

java语言编程Random类生成不重复的随机数?

因为你手动指定了随机数种子,使用new Random()不带参数的构造器可解。

在WORD里,怎么产生随机数?

解决思路是:1、随机产生10个不重复的数字,2、对10个数字大小排序,获得随机1-10。
————————————————————————————————
在B1-B10输入 RANDBETWEEN(1,10) RANDBETWEEN(1,10)/100
在A1输入公式 RANK.EQ(B1,$B$1:$B$10,0),获得B1:B10的排序(这里用的是降序)
以上方法产生重复的概率比RANDBETWEEN(1,10)低很多

excel数字不重复怎么设置?

步骤1:打开Excel文件
步骤2:选中要录入随机数据的单元格区域
步骤3:点击选项
步骤4:点击【随机重复】,选择【生成随机数】
步骤5:在选项内设置生成随机数的最大值最小值等选项
步骤6:取消勾选【允许重复】,最后点击【确定】即可完成

怎么求0到9的不重复随机数?

A2数组公式,输入后不要直接回车,要按三键 CTRL SHIFT 回车 下拉。或者用这公式也行:(此公式输入后直接回车即可,无需按三键)SMALL(IF(COUNTIF(A$1:A1,{0;1;2;3;4;5;6;7;8;9})0,{0;1;2;3;4;5;6;7;8;9}),INT(RAND()*(10-ROW(A1))) 1)

C语言:如何产生不重复的随机数字?

将已经产生的随机数保存下来,然后在获取到新的随机数时,与之前保存下来的值进行对比,如果已经出现过则抛弃,并再次获取,直到获取到不同的随机值为止。
以获取10个0~100之间的不重复随机数为例,代码如下:
#include
#include
#include
int main()
{
int list[10], i,j, a
srand(time(null))//设置随机数种子。
for(i 0 i lt 10 i )
{
while(1)
{
a rand()0 //获取一个0~100之间的随机数。
for(j 0 j lt i j )
if(list[j] a) break//检查重复。
if(j i)//没有重复值,保存到list中。
{
list[i] a
break
}
}
}
for(i 0 i lt 10 i )//打印获取到的随机数序列。
printf(